§ 330

Special pay: accession bonus for officer candidates

37 U.S.C. § 330.
2 min read
Subchapter: EXISTING SPECIAL PAY, INCENTIVE PAY, AND BONUS AUTHORITIES
((a)) ** .—** Under regulations prescribed by the Secretary concerned, a person who executes a written agreement described in subsection (c) may be paid an accession bonus under this section upon acceptance of the agreement by the Secretary concerned. ((b)) ** .—** The amount of an accession bonus under subsection (a) may not exceed $8,000. ((c)) ** .—** A written agreement referred to in subsection (a) is a written agreement by a person— ((1)) to complete officer candidate school; ((2)) to accept a commission or appointment as an officer of the armed forces; and ((3)) to serve on active duty as a commissioned officer for a period specified in the agreement. ((d)) ** .—** Upon acceptance of a written agreement under subsection (a) by the Secretary concerned, the total amount of the accession bonus payable under the agreement becomes fixed. The agreement shall specify whether the accession bonus will be paid in a lump sum or installments. ((e)) ** .—** A person who, having received all or part of the bonus under a written agreement under subsection (a), does not complete the total period of active duty as a commissioned officer as specified in such agreement shall be subject to the repayment provisions of . ((f)) ** .—** No agreement under this section may be entered into after .
